A sacred chant framed by greenery: Saint Cecilia in a pine crown by Hans Thoma
The composition features a serene face and a dense pine crown, where deep greens respond to the warm tones of the complexion. The precise brushwork and delicate modeling reveal mastery of detail, suggesting a soft light caressing the saint's features. The atmosphere is intimate, almost contemplative, evoking both devotion and closeness to nature. The graphic elements — branches, foliage, and gazes — create a soothing visual rhythm that invites meditation and calm admiration.

Hans Thoma, master of intimate realism and landscape symbolism
German painter of the 19th century, Hans Thoma is recognized for his blend of precise realism and symbolist tones, influenced by rural traditions and folk art. His palette favors subdued harmonies and subtle transitions, giving each portrait a quiet dignity. Thoma contributed to renewing the depiction of religious subjects by anchoring them in natural settings, bringing the sacred closer to everyday life. His work, appreciated by collectors for its execution quality, reflects a constant search for accuracy and discreet emotion.
